Fushigi Yuugi Kanzenban (Perfect Version)

A recompilation of the original manga into 9 vols. Each vol. contains twice as many pages as the original version, are A5 size (6" x 8"), and are printed on better quality paper. All pages that were originally illustrated in color are in color here with the exception of the "Harem of Men" manga. (But since that was printed in color in the 1st artbook it's not a big deal that it isn't in color here.) The series also contains new extras as well as newly done character profiles. And if you look under the removable cover you'll find some character sketches underneath.

On the con side, the Kanzenban version doesn't include the Watase Yuu freetalks or some of the original extras (Most notably the Fushigi Akugi) and it does cost more than the original version.

If you're only going to get one version, this is the one to get as its pros far outweigh its cons. However, die-hard FY fans who can read Japanese will probably want to own both versions.
